Integrating natural and engineered genetic variations to decode regulatory influence on blood traits.
Cell reports - 24 Feb 2026
Tardaguila Manuel, Von Schiller Dominique, Colombo Michela, Gori Ilaria, Coomber Eve L, Vanderstichele Thomas, Benaglio Paola, Chiereghin Chiara, Gerety Sebastian, Vuckovic Dragana, Landini Arianna, Clerici Giuditta, Casiraghi Aurora, Albers Patrick, Ray-Jones Helen, Burnham Katie L, Tokolyi Alex, Persyn Elodie, Spivakov Mikhail, Sankaran Vijay G, Walter Klaudia, Kundu Kousik, Pirastu Nicola, Inouye Michael, Paul Dirk S, Davenport Emma E, Sahlén Pelin, Watt Stephen, Soranzo Nicole
Abstract excerpt
Understanding the function of genetic variants associated with human traits and diseases remains a significant challenge. Here, we combined analyses based on natural genetic variation and genetic engineering to dissect the function of 94 non-coding variants associated with hematological traits. We describe 22 genetic variants impacting hematological variation through gene expression. Further, through in-depth...
